Dont eat refrigerated smoked seafood unless its in a cooked dish, such as a casserole, that reaches an internal temperature of 165F to kill harmful germs. Throw away any food that's been sitting out for longer than two hours, or one hour if the food is in temperatures above 90 degrees F. And reheat previously cooked leftovers until steaming (165 degrees F). Unpasteurized juice, even fresh-squeezed juice, and cider can cause foodborne illness. The FDA recommends the following guidelines: Beef, Veal, or Lamb Steaks and Roasts: 145 degrees F. Pork: 160-170 degrees F. Ground Beef: 160 degrees F. Ground Poultry: 165 degrees F. Chicken . Fish and other protein-rich foods have nutrients that can help a child's growth and development.
